How to backup Microsoft Outlook contact and emails
To backup Outlook database, you first need to search your PC for outlook data file. These files are with pst extension. See below,
1) Choose > Start Button -> Search -> Search for Files
1) Choose > Start Button -> Search -> Search for Files
2) Type *.pst in the seach box and press 'Enter'
3) The outlook data files with names ending with .pst will be listed
4) Copy the paste the files to your backup drive or external hard disk
5) Below is how I backup into my SD Card
6) Remember to close Microsoft Outlook before backup because Windows doesn't allow you to copy opened files.

Windows 8 Acer Iconia W510 tablet
My first experience with Windows 8 on Acer Iconia W510 tablet / laptop
After waiting 1 week for the stock to arrive, I had finally started my adventure with Windows 8.
Mine is Acer Iconia W510 with Intel Atom processor, 2GB RAM & 64 GB storage.
You can use it with a dock keyboard or just use it as a table.
The first thing I like to highlight is that it's not a iPad. The user experience is no where near iPad. The tablet is hard to hold, screen isn't easy to navigate with touch and applications are not so touch friendly.
As a laptop, the screen it a little too small and a little slow.
But, it still do both quite OK. Just ok that I don't get frustrated using it.
Windows 8 is a little weird with the new metro & desktop without start button.It uses the Windows button to navigate.
While in dock mode, I use the Windows desktop. While in tablet mode, I would use the metro icons.
After a few days testing, I feel that I can live with this as my laptop & tablet.
I have long trying to leave my laptop behind and use my tablet but tablet are just not ready for everyday work.
So the hybrid tablet & laptop is still the best for my job as a IT manager.
Now I just carry my Acer Iconia along insted of a tablet and laptop everywhere.
